Features of beret knitting technology

The birthplace of berets is France. Moreover, initially it was a headdress for male citizens, and then a mandatory part of the military uniform. Over time, women picked up the tradition of wearing berets, appreciating their convenience: in the cold season they warm their heads, and in the summer heat they protect them from the sun's rays. In addition, such headdresses look great on little girls, making them look like dolls. Thus, there are many reasons to master the technology of knitting this wardrobe item.

If you want to know all the features of knitting berets, then first you should take into account some of the nuances of choosing yarn:

  • for berets, as a rule, synthetic threads are used: they hold their shape well and do not stretch;
  • on average, a beret takes about 200 g of yarn;
  • depending on the pattern of the model, the thickness of the yarn is selected: the more voluminous the pattern, the thicker the threads should be;
  • openwork patterns on berets look better if the yarn is not too thin;
  • it is better to make a double band from thin threads (the part that holds the headdress on the head);
  • For a baby beret, you can use cotton threads.

Before you begin to scrutinize how to crochet a beret, you need to choose not only the model, but also the hook itself. Its thickness depends on the thickness of the yarn, but hook No. 4 is considered optimal - it is convenient to knit with both thin threads and denser ones.

    One of the most popular hats for girls is the summer beret. It is most convenient to crochet it, as it takes a round shape. And circular crochet is easy. Crocheting berets for girls is a fascinating activity. In just a couple of evenings you can knit a beautiful beret for either spring or summer.

    Summer berets are lighter, openwork. Berets for spring are knitted with a denser pattern and warmer threads. The beginning and middle of spring are often cool, which means you can sew a lining for such a beret.

    Before you start knitting a beret, you need to learn the basics and features of knitting this headdress. As we have already said, the base of the beret is a circle. It is called the bottom. In the table you can see approximate sizes for the beret.

    But before crocheting a beret, be sure to check the head size of the child for whom you will crochet it. To check the diameter of the beret, you need to place it on a flat surface. Knitting in the round is achieved by uniformly adding stitches throughout the knitting pattern. Then the product will naturally expand.

    The next part of the beret is called the walls. They are knitted without adding stitches and usually reach a height of 3-10 cm.

    After the walls, part of the decreases begins. It is smaller than the walls - from two to four centimeters.

    And the last part is the band. Its height is from 1 to 10 cm. This part of the beret must correspond to the size of the head and thanks to it the beret will fit well. If your band turned out to be too wide, then you can knit it with a crochet hook of a smaller number and, conversely, if it turned out to be too narrow, then use a crochet hook of a larger number.

    You need to take measurements correctly. To do this, the measuring tape should pass 2 cm above the eyebrows, just above the ear and through the most protruding point of the back of the head.

    How to determine the size of the future beret?

    Just as with any thing, before starting to make a beret, it is necessary to clearly determine its initial dimensions. If for sewing clothes you need to find out the circumference of the waist, chest, hips and other things, then here you need to measure:

    • Head circumference;

    Using a polymer centimeter, measure the widest part of the head. To do this, the tape is wrapped from a point on the forehead (on the bridge of the nose) to the most protruding bone on the back of the head and back.

    • depth of the headdress;

    It is measured across the top of the head from the lobe of one ear to the lobe of the other. The measured value is divided in half.

    Preliminary preparation for knitting

    Beginning needlewomen are always eager to get to work quickly in the hope that the result will surprise you from the first minutes. Will surprise. Just not from the best side. All the work will go down the drain if you don’t first determine the degree of stretch and shrinkage of the yarn. The threads that will be used for knitting may have different properties. If you do not take them into account, the finished headdress may be two sizes too large. Therefore, before crocheting a beret, you need to make a sample. Sample photos of what they look like are below:


    The sample should be a small copy of the knitting pattern for the beret itself. With its help, the needlewoman will understand how many loops are needed to adjust the width and diameter of the product. The size of the resulting piece should be 10x10 cm or larger. After knitting, the sample is washed, dried and ironed. With such processing, it will become clear how a product knitted from such yarn will behave. When the sample takes its final shape, you need to calculate from it how many loops fit into a piece measuring 1x1 cm. By multiplying the resulting number by the value of the head circumference and the depth of the headdress, you get the estimated number of loops for knitting.

    How to crochet a beret?

    As soon as you have a suitable pattern on hand and all the measurements have been taken, it’s time to start knitting. The beret is knitted in four stages:

    • knitting the bottom (the part that will cover the back of the head and crown). All the work will consist of tying the base ring in a circle with gradually adding loops and increasing the diameter of the product;
    • knitting a flat part that will smooth out the bend of the beret;
    • decreasing the loops to the size of the head circumference. Now everything happens in the reverse order, the number of loops is reduced at the same points where they were added while knitting the bottom;
    • knitting elastic bands. As soon as the lower edge of the beret begins to fit the head and forehead, an elastic band is knitted, thanks to which the headdress will not slip off.

    The resulting product can be decorated to your taste. Beads, buttons, ribbons, knitted “donuts” and so on can be used as decoration. But even without additional decoration, a beret can look very elegant.

    Crochet summer beret, job description

    Before starting work, make a beret pattern; the outer circle (bottom) with a diameter of 28-30 cm and the inner circle with a diameter of the outer circle of 28-30 cm, the inner circle - 16-18 cm. The diameter of the inner circle is calculated as follows: the circumference of your head minus 2 cm for a tight fit, divided by 3, 14. If this is a standard head circumference (56-2): 3.14 = 17.2 cm.

    So, the diameter of the small circle is about 16-18 cm. Tie together the elements: flowers (diagram 24, 24 a), leaves (diagram 24 b), leaves on branches (diagram 24 c). Lay out the finished elements on the pattern with the wrong side up, making bouquet compositions (for an option, see cx 24 g), secure with pins. Use polystyrene foam as a backing. Connect the bouquets together with an irregular grid in a circle (this is important), especially along the edge of the circle. Try to ensure that the mesh along the edges does not stretch into a line, but is in the form of rounded arches. Inside the circle, the knitting direction can be arbitrary. Thread the ends of the threads into the elements. Similarly, assemble the inner circle part.

    Fold the two finished parts with the right sides facing each other and connect them together as follows: RLS with loop grip (under the arch), both parts, 5VP.
    The seam should be movable and not tighten the fabric.

    Knit the headband on a machine (“Braer” 7th class on density 4) 20 stitches in stockinette stitch 230-240 rows from “Iris”. It can be knitted on thin knitting needles by calculating the density yourself.

    Tie the headband in the same way as you connected the beret parts. Sew the ends of the headband using a knit stitch. The rim itself will curl beautifully into a roll. You can fix it at the place where the ends are sewn together.

    Crochet beret for a girl for spring: diagram and description

    The beret presented below is most relevant in the spring. It is decorated with a large beautiful flower, which is knitted separately.

    The beret pattern itself is quite simple, even a beginner can handle it. All you need is a little patience and following the tips below.

    What is needed to knit such a beret for spring:

    • 100 g of beautiful pink yarn
    • hook 1.7

    How to knit a beret for a girl:

    Step 1. You need to knit a circle with simple double crochets. The diameter of the circle is calculated as follows: the circumference of the child’s head divided by 2. So, if the circumference of the child’s head is 48 cm, then the circle needs to be knitted with a diameter of 24 cm.

    Step 2. Knit several rows with simple single crochets and without increasing.

    Step 3. It is necessary to decrease 1 stitch in each wedge; to do this, knit two stitches together.

    Step 4. After about a few rows (3 or 4) decreases, start knitting an elastic band. This is done with the same crochet hook, using alternating concave and convex double crochet stitches. In total, you need to knit from 5 to 7 rows.



    In principle, you can stop at step 4, but if you want to make a really beautiful thing, try knitting a flower.

    The flower is knitted according to the following pattern.



    A detailed description of knitting such a flower, only in black, will be given below.





    Photo from the reverse side of the flower






    Now sew the flower to the hat. Ready! An original beret for a girl is ready for spring!

    Important note! It is not necessary to use the same color yarn for the flower and beret. A pink or blue hat with a white flower, or a white beret with a scarlet flower will look very beautiful. Experiment!
